Advertorial FALL TRENDS Fashion & Jewelry The Pearl Revolution Continues... FRINGE & LAYERING A sense of motion was key on the runways for Fall. Freeing that post-lockdown couped-up feeling inspired a plethora of fringe, in both fabrics and accessories. Chanel, Dolce & Gabbana, and Jil Sander featured pearl fringe with long beaded ropes swaying as necklaces or built into the fabric itself. Jean Paul Gaultier and Prabal Gurung opted instead for layered and jumbled pearl strands, both short and long. Dries Van Noten featured pearl rings, while Ports 1961, Schiaparelli and Stella Jean featured crystal or gemstone cocktail rings on 2 or more fingers. Carolina Herrera, Oscar de la Renta, and Alessandra Rich opting for sizable pearl drops. Christian Dior paired tweeds with the simplicity and luster of studs.
